THIS PROJECT CONSISTS OF THE INSTALLATION OF WATER, SEWER AND NATURAL GAS PIPING INTO A PROPOSED NEW PEB LOCATED IN THE RED HORSE COMPLEX ON THE FORMER RUNWAY APRON AT MAFB. is a federal award for Fa4626 341 Cons Lgc held by Geranios Enterprises, Inc. Estimated value $750K ($750K obligated). Current period of performance ends Nov 30, 2025. Last award drew 3 bidders. Place of performance: MALMSTROM AFB MT.

THIS PROJECT CONSISTS OF THE INSTALLATION OF WATER, SEWER AND NATURAL GAS PIPING INTO A PROPOSED NEW PEB LOCATED IN THE RED HORSE COMPLEX ON THE FORMER RUNWAY APRON AT MAFB.
